Clinton Announces New U.S. Commitment to Higher Education in Pakistan

Secretary of State Hillary Rodham Clinton has announced a $45 million contribution to the Pakistani Higher Education Commission (HEC). According to the U.S. Department of State press release, the funds will be used for the purposes of:

  • Expanding relationships between Pakistani universities and U.S. institutions through increasing additional academic exchanges
  • Increasing university and technical education for students who have been displaced by violence and to those living in vulnerable areas such as southern Punjab and the North West Frontier Province, which serves students from the Federally Administered Tribal Areas.
  • Enabling the Higher Education Commission to exempt displaced students from fees, expand opportunities for students to become health professionals, and expand engineering and women’s education.
  • Supporting infrastructure upgrades and improved teacher training at both vocational and university institutions.
